发明名称 BATTERIES USING VERTICALLY FREE STANDING GRAPHENE, CARBON NANOSHEETS, AND/OR THREE DIMENSIONAL CARBON NANOSTRUCTURES AS ELECTRODES
摘要 A graphene-based battery includes an anode, a cathode and an electrolyte. The electrodes of anode and cathode include vertically free-standing graphene, carbon nanosheets, and/or three- dimensional (3D) carbon nanostructures in various configurations. For example, the carbon nanosheets are disposed orthogonally to a surface, and include a single layer or multiple layers of graphene. The vertically free-standing carbon nanosheets are coated with an active material as the cathode. A liquid, gel or solid-state electrolyte is either pseudo-morphologically coated on the surface of free-standing carbon nanosheets, or fully impregnates the space between the free¬ standing carbon nanosheets. Essentially, the vertically free-standing carbon nanosheets function as space-organizers at nanoscale. By partitioning the space between the anode and the cathode, the vertically free-standing carbon nanosheets can greatly enlarge the surface area of the loaded active material, and provide utterly high electrical conductivity, by virtue of physical properties of graphene.
